In a riveting turn of events at WWE Bad Blood 2024, the atmosphere was electric as Cody Rhodes and Roman Reigns teamed up to face The Bloodline, represented by Solo Sikoa and Jacob Fatu. The blue brand’s representation didn’t stop there; the spotlight also shone brightly on the WWE Women’s Championship match, where Nia Jax successfully defended her title against Bayley. However, the post-match drama left fans buzzing, particularly regarding the intriguing dynamics brewing between Jax and her friend, Tiffany Stratton.

Tiffany Stratton’s Big Moment

After Jax’s victory, tensions escalated when Stratton teased a potential Money in the Bank (MITB) cash-in, igniting a fiery response from Jax. This teasing segment not only set the stage for the upcoming episode of SmackDown but also hinted at a significant character shift for Stratton, who could soon transition into a babyface role.

Tiffany Stratton’s Journey to the Main Roster

Since her debut on the main roster in February 2024, Tiffany Stratton has been making waves in the WWE landscape. Her rapid ascent has included competing in high-profile matches, such as the Elimination Chamber, and securing the 2024 Women’s Money in the Bank Ladder Match title at a previous PLE. Stratton’s journey has not only showcased her talent but also her resilience in adapting to the spotlight of the WWE’s main stage.

A New Era for SmackDown

In a candid interview with David LaGreca on Busted Open, Stratton reflected on her transition from NXT to SmackDown.

“Immediately when I got called up, I was so nervous. I didn’t know any of the girls in the locker room. I was never in front of big audiences. I was always in front of the same 5,200 people at NXT,” she revealed, highlighting the challenges she faced in adjusting to larger audiences and different states week after week.
